I think the distinct lack of suspense in the Rumble winner could be due in part to the unification of the belts. It seemed like in past years each belt had their own unique set of challengers who were big deals, viable contenders, etc and now they don't have that. If the belts were still split guys like Rey, Del Rio, Langston, Reigns, etc could be considered as threats to win the Rumble because they could challenge for the lesser WHC and still let WWE do whatever they want with the WWE Championship while still honoring the stipulation of the Rumble.
